One trigger, two payouts: each time a DRUKHARI unit from your army disembarks from a TRANSPORT, until the end of the turn, ranged weapons equipped by models in that unit have [IGNORES COVER] and melee weapons equipped by models in that unit have [LANCE].
Both halves are exactly what Drukhari infantry lack. Ignores Cover solves the problem that splinter weapons are volume rather than quality, so the squad in ruins on the objective stops getting a save it did not earn. Lance adds +1 to Wound on a charge, which is the armour penetration Wyches and Incubi have never had.
And because the rule names DRUKHARI, not a pillar, it pays your Kabalites, your Wyches, your Wracks and your mercenaries identically. That is unique in the faction and it is why a mixed collection should look here first.
The cost is structural rather than a restriction: you must own transports, and a unit only benefits on the turn it disembarks, so this is a detachment that wants to keep moving.
